What's your recommendations to make regid sheets of carbon to use as a flat floor on a race car? Will be done using resin infusion.

How about 2-3 layers of carbon + suitable core + 2-3 layers of carbon?
By ajb100 - 12/8/2015 7:25:43 AM

It depends on how often it's attached to the chassis of the car. The fibreglass floors on our Ginettas are only about 3mm thick and withstand the diver climbing in and out with no problems, including the heavy mechanic stomping around inside it.

One thing to consider with vehicle floors is weight distribution. Is it an actual competition car? If so are you on the minimum weight? If your already having to add ballast, then leaving the floor as is or making a heavier floor is better.
